About Investment Law in Viborg, Denmark

Viborg is a dynamic city in Central Jutland, Denmark, known for its welcoming business climate and diverse economic landscape. Investment in Viborg can range from real estate and business acquisitions to stock and securities transactions. The legal framework governing investments is largely grounded in Danish national law, supplemented by local regulations and European Union directives. For both local and foreign investors, understanding the specific provisions that apply in Viborg is vital to avoid pitfalls and make successful, compliant investments.

Local Laws Overview

Investment in Viborg is subject to Danish national laws, EU regulations, and local Viborg Municipality guidelines. Key aspects to consider include:

  • Business Formation Laws: Setting up a business requires registration with the Danish Business Authority and compliance with relevant employment, tax, and corporate governance laws.
  • Real Estate Regulations: Property investments, especially by non-EU residents, are governed by specific rules, including reporting requirements and municipal zoning laws.
  • Securities and Financial Investments: Regulated by the Danish Financial Supervisory Authority, ensuring transparency, anti-money laundering compliance, and investor protection.
  • Taxation: Investors must adhere to Danish tax laws, including income tax, capital gains, and property tax, which may differ for individuals and companies.
  • Environmental and Planning Laws: Some investments, particularly in real estate and industry, must comply with local environmental impact assessments and planning approvals.

Understanding these laws is crucial for making safe and profitable investments in Viborg.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can foreigners invest in Viborg, Denmark?

Yes, both EU and non-EU residents can invest in Viborg. However, non-EU investors may face additional requirements, especially when investing in real estate.

What are the main types of investment opportunities in Viborg?

Common opportunities include real estate, setting up businesses, buying shares in local companies, and investing in sectors like manufacturing, technology, or renewable energy.

Do I need to register my investment with any authority?

Most business and property investments must be registered with the relevant Danish authorities, such as the Danish Business Authority or the municipality.

Are there any restrictions on foreign ownership of property?

Yes, non-EU citizens may need approval from the Danish Ministry of Justice to purchase property. EU/EEA citizens have more freedom to invest.

How is investment income taxed in Denmark?

Investment income, including dividends, interest, and capital gains, is subject to Danish taxation. Tax rates and rules depend on your residency status and the type of income.

What legal protections do investors have in Viborg?

Investors benefit from strong legal protections under Danish law, including property rights, contract enforcement, and transparent dispute resolution mechanisms.

What due diligence should I perform before investing?

Due diligence includes verifying the legal status of assets, checking for debts or encumbrances, reviewing contracts, and ensuring regulatory compliance.

Can I get a residency permit by investing in Viborg?

Denmark does not offer a direct citizenship or residency-by-investment program. Residency permits may be possible via business or employment visas under certain conditions.

What should I do if I face a dispute related to my investment?

Seek legal advice promptly. Many disputes can be resolved through negotiation or mediation, but litigation is also an option in Danish courts if necessary.
